Output 153c054753edddfcfb9e97b7b926a043927f5c911268d01d64a45180b47e5c05:11

value
681804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351a44125e75833faa48479d8d04862dd86a04eb OP_EQUAL
address
36XoChRrTA3kvkg6BP7eSeRToj3JFsSY2A
transaction
153c054753edddfcfb9e97b7b926a043927f5c911268d01d64a45180b47e5c05
spent
true